Active school mode (i.e. going to school with your Sim)
I'm not a fan of the idea of going to the school just to do day-to-day school stuff but I'd LOVE if we were able to partake in special events like:
- Craft/Science Fair where you spend a week preparing for it then at the end of the week you present it and be able to win a ribbon.
- School dances would be neat. You can ask another teen to be your date and take them to the school for homecoming or prom and are able to win king/queen. Maybe for the mischievous ones be able to sabotage the punch.
- GRADUATION! I would love to be able to see my sims accept their diploma.
